Morehead would probably work as an eastern KY location. Easy access via I64. Fine riding to the east on the awesome route 32. It sits at the north end of the Daniel Boone National Forest which has some fine riding. College town near Cave Run Lake. Lots of chain hotels, restaurants, gas, etc. Although Rowan is a dry county, the city of Morehead is "wet", so you can buy beer/etc there.
Personally, I think that's getting quite a ways from the east coast (Morehead is a full day ride from Pittsburgh) so you would be pulling from a different set of STN members (more central than eastern), but it'd be a good spot for a meet of some sort.
RE: Camping
I strongly prefer a motel to camping. Camping requires a whole bunch of extra stuff to schlep around. That said, I had a good time at the Seneca Rocks campout, so I'm not totally adverse to it. It's not like you're setting up camp and tearing it down every day. But there's a lot to be said for air conditioning, a dry bed, and a hot shower at the end of a long day of riding.
